What is IELTS?
IELTS is a standardized test that assesses English language proficiency. It examines an individual's abilities in four locations: Listening, Reading, Writing, and Speaking. The test is extensively recognized by universities, employers, and immigration authorities around the world.

What is a good IELTS score?
A score of 7 or above is typically thought about a good rating for admission into reliable universities. Nevertheless, various organizations might have differing score requirements.
2. For how long is the IELTS rating valid?
IELTS ratings stand for 2 years. After this period, prospects will require to retake the test if they need a new score.
